Doesn’t fit at ‘Safe Store’ storage facility
I’m sure this padlock is great (it’s certainly weighty) but I bought it specifically to lock up my possessions in a storage facility whilst I’m moving house and the shackle is too thick. I did some research on this padlock before I bought it so maybe it’s just at ‘Safe Store’ that these don’t fit. Would advise people in the same situation to ask their storage facility what the maximum shackle size is before they buy.

Solid and weighty
This is a solid well made lock. My only criticism is that the key can sometimes be difficult to insert, maybe down to the anti-drill collar moving slightly. Comes with 2 keys, more can be ordered. Don't think your local key cutter would be able to reproduce them. Used with Henry Squire LB2CSRH Right Handed Shielded Bracket. to protect my workshop.
